Transaction 62687da029a98832546b72588915e69af7fc379dfa491f16375639e2b0541465

1 Input
2 Outputs
  • 62687da029a98832546b72588915e69af7fc379dfa491f16375639e2b0541465:0
  • value  50400
    address  1HDi79U92EgefP1iBwzxe4uvKs9kfnWLwE
  • 62687da029a98832546b72588915e69af7fc379dfa491f16375639e2b0541465:1
  • value  1315607
    address  bc1qs2pcxt8zaspter63hs8eveqg0kquhkcj3jcupj